I wanted to choose a theme that everyone could participate in regardless of equipment or experience, so for this week’s theme I’m choosing “blur.” There are many different ways to incorporate blur in photography—slow shutter speeds, shallow depth of field, intentional movement of the camera, panning, or adding it after the fact while editing your image. It’s a wide open field, and I’m excited to see what everyone creates!
